What is your typical process for working with a new customer?

unfold fold
Our typical process for working with a new customer starts with an onsite appointment to assess your needs and get a better understanding of the project. After that, we provide a detailed proposal outlining the scope of work, timeline, and costs. Once the proposal is reviewed and approved, we’ll schedule a start date and begin the work. We focus on clear communication at every step to ensure everything meets your expectations and is completed on time.

What questions should customers think through before talking to professionals about their project?

unfold fold
Before talking to a professional, customers should really think about what their vision is for the project—what they’re hoping to achieve and the details they want to include. The more specific they can be about what they’re looking for, the better. It’s also important to have a clear idea of the budget they’re willing to spend, as this helps ensure that expectations are realistic and aligned with what can be done. Knowing these two things upfront can make the whole process more efficient and help professionals give a more accurate proposal.
